Chemical Property of 2-Bromo-4'-nitroacetophenone
Chemical Property:
- Appearance/Colour:yellow to orange crystalline powder
- Vapor Pressure:0.000233mmHg at 25°C
- Melting Point:94-99 °C(lit.)
- Refractive Index:1.609
- Boiling Point:325.2 °C at 760 mmHg
- Flash Point:150.5 °C
- PSA:62.89000
- Density:1.671 g/cm3
- LogP:2.69560
- Storage Temp.:under inert gas (nitrogen or Argon) at 2-8°C
- XLogP3:2.3
- Hydrogen Bond Donor Count:0
- Hydrogen Bond Acceptor Count:3
- Rotatable Bond Count:2
- Exact Mass:242.95311
- Heavy Atom Count:13
- Complexity:206

Uses
2-Bromo-4′-nitroacetophenone was used to study the pKa of the histidine-34 imidazole.
